DALLAS, Texas - February 14th, 2005 - Workbrain Corporation (TSX: WB) today announced that Lifespan, Rhode Island's largest provider of health services, has selected Workbrain for Healthcare to improve payroll accuracy across its hospital network. The industry specific workforce management solution will help Lifespan automate manual workforce processes and standardize the application of pay policies for over 10,000 employees. Workbrain made the announcement from the Healthcare Information Management Systems Society (HIMSS) conference taking place this week in Dallas, Texas.

Workbrain for Healthcare is a suite of Web-based applications that features nurse and staff scheduling, time and attendance, employee self-service and Workbrain Intelligence analytics. Lifespan selected Workbrain following an extensive review process that evaluated multiple workforce management systems. The healthcare provider will use Workbrain solutions to ensure consistent and accurate application of union contract rules and pay policies, including entitlements and shift premium calculations.

Workbrain's end-to-end healthcare solution drives significant benefits for hospital organizations. Census and acuity-based labor forecasting and scheduling ensures that the right staff is deployed to meet patient needs. Nurses and other hospital staff can access unique self-scheduling features such as online shift trading to build more flexibility into their schedules. Fully integrated time and attendance ensures compliance with government regulations and pay contracts, and industry specific intelligence dashboards deliver real-time analysis of key performance metrics. Employee self-service allows nurses and other hospital employees to submit leave requests, check schedules and review timesheets from any standard web browser. Workbrain for Healthcare integrates easily with hospital systems, including census and acuity, HRMS and payroll.
